Weapon (longsword), legendary (requires attunement by a A creature with a strength score of 18)

This long thin black and silver blade looks like an extremely elongated razor, the cross guard is covered in runes and seems to be riveted with diamonds.

You gain a +3 bonus to attack and damage rolls made with this magic weapon. In addition, the weapon ignores resistance to slashing damage.

This blade can also cast Darkness 3x per day, with all spent charges being returned at dawn.

When you attack a creature that has at least one head with this weapon and roll a 20 on the attack roll, you cut off one of the creature's heads. The creature dies if it can't survive without the lost head. A creature is immune to this effect if it is immune to slashing damage, doesn't have or need a head, or has legendary actions. Such a creature instead takes an extra 6d8 slashing damage from the hit.

Proficiency with a Longsword allows you to add your proficiency bonus to the attack roll for any attack you make with it.


This weapon has the following mastery property. To use this property, you must have a feature that lets you use it.

Sap. If you hit a creature with this weapon, that creature has Disadvantage on its next attack roll before the start of your next turn.
